Output 50d7cae489a34b0ba308cc56df41ff22b86c852f00f11f19e01f49ab7cc72a34:969

value
104481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 630148f5eedf77beda4467af01be7b5eab98f4bf OP_EQUAL
address
3AiWMpRjanXNkDmvwjzjFT4BWRnN9S2LPd
transaction
50d7cae489a34b0ba308cc56df41ff22b86c852f00f11f19e01f49ab7cc72a34
spent
true